### 引言
在当今的新兴技术浪潮中,区块链技术正逐渐成为多个行业的核心力量,特别是在社交平台领域。区块链为社交应用提供了去中心化的特性,能够有效提升用户信任和数据安全。本篇文章将详细介绍如何成功打造一个社交平台区块链项目,并回答一些相关问题,以帮助您理解这一复杂的过程。
### 社交平台区块链项目的基础
区块链是一种分散式的数据库技术,能够在没有中央控制的情况下实现数据的安全存储和转移。在社交平台的环境中,区块链可以用于简化用户验证、保护用户数据隐私以及实现更透明的内容管理。
#### 1. 项目定义与目标
成功的社交平台区块链项目首先需要明确其目标。例如,您可能希望建立一个去中心化的社交网络,让用户获得对自己数据的控制权,或是创建一个基于区块链的数字内容交易平台,让内容创作者和消费者之间的交易更为便利。
#### 2. 技术选型
一个成功的区块链项目需要选择合适的技术栈。常见的区块链技术包括以太坊、EOS和Hyperledger Fabric等。选择时,需考虑以下因素:
- **安全性**:确保所选平台具有良好的安全性,能够防止数据泄露和攻击。
- **可扩展性**:能够支持大量用户的使用需求。
- **社区与支持**: 一个活跃的社区会为项目的持续发展提供帮助,包括技术支持和生态系统的扩张。
### 社交平台区块链项目的开发流程
#### 1. 需求分析
在开发之前,必须进行深入的需求分析。这包括确定目标用户群体、功能模块,以及如何最好地利用区块链特性来解决用户痛点。可以通过问卷调查、用户访谈等方式获取反馈,以确保项目的针对性和有效性。
#### 2. 原型设计
通过设计平台的初步原型,您能够将想法变为现实。这一阶段可以使用工具如Sketch或Figma来创建可视化的界面,并进行用户测试,根据反馈不断设计。
#### 3. 开发
在开发过程中,团队需要将前期的设计和需求转化为代码。通常,此过程分为前端和后端开发。前端主要负责用户界面的实现,而后端则主要负责处理数据、区块链交互等功能。
- **前端**:选择适合的框架(如React或Vue.js)来构建用户界面。需要考虑用户体验,以确保界面的友好性和可用性。
- **后端**:使用Node.js、Python或Go等编程语言进行开发,构建智能合约和数据库交互。
#### 4. 测试
在完成开发后,必须进行充分的测试,包括单元测试、集成测试和用户测试。确保平台在各种情况下的稳定性和安全性至关重要。
#### 5. 部署与上线
部署阶段需要选择合适的服务器和区块链网络。根据项目需求,您可以选择公链、私链或联盟链进行部署。上线后,不要忘记进行宣传推广,以吸引用户注册使用。
### 社交平台区块链项目的运营和维护
#### 1. 用户增长
为了持续增长用户群体,您可以进行市场营销、社区建设等活动。积极参与社交媒体,组织线上线下活动,能够提高知名度和吸引力。
#### 2. 数据安全与隐私保护
在社交平台上,用户的数据安全和隐私保护至关重要。利用区块链的加密特性,确保用户数据的安全存储与传输。此外,定期进行安全审计,以防止潜在的安全威胁。
#### 3. 持续更新与
根据用户反馈和市场变化,定期更新平台的功能与界面。这可以包括增加新的功能模块、用户体验等。
#### 4. 社区管理与互动
通过建立社区,定期进行互动,让用户感受到参与的价值。您可以设立用户反馈渠道,保持与用户的良好沟通,持续提升用户的粘性。
### 相关问题探讨
#### 区块链如何增强社交平台的安全性?
区块链技术本质上是依靠去中心化的特点来增强安全性的。与传统集中式平台不同,去中心化平台不会将用户数据集中存储在单一数据库中,而是分布式存储在多个节点上。这种方式有效减少了数据被黑客攻击的风险。
在具体实现上,区块链的加密算法确保了数据的安全,只有获得授权的用户才能访问数据。这意味着即便服务器遭受到攻击,数据也不会被窃取或篡改。此外,对于敏感个人信息,可以采用零知识证明技术,让用户在保护隐私的前提下,仍然能够证明自己的身份或者资格。
区块链还便于实现追溯功能。例如,在内容创作领域,所有的内容因其存在于区块链上而可追踪,这对于打击抄袭和盗版行为极为有效。通过记录每一次编辑和发布,平台可以保持内容的原始性及真实性,增强用户对平台的信任。
总之,通过利用区块链的特性,社交平台不仅能提高安全性,还能建立用户的信任感,为用户提供一个安全、透明的社交环境。
#### 社交平台区块链项目的盈利模式有哪些?
针对社交平台的盈利模式,区块链项目有多种选择,可以结合平台的特点作出灵活运用。以下是几种常见的盈利模式:
1. **交易手续费**:平台可以对用户之间的交易收取一定比例的手续费,特别是在数字内容和数字资产的交易过程中,手续费往往是主要的收入来源。
2. **广告收入**:尽管传统社交网络的广告模式常常受到用户的抵制,但在区块链社交平台中,可以采用更为透明和去中心化的方式提供广告服务,用户将能决定是否观看广告并根据观看情况获得奖励。
3. **订阅服务**:可为用户提供增值服务,如高级账户、额外存储空间等,通过订阅方式实现持续的收入流。
4. **代币经济**:平台可以发行自己的代币,作为交易的媒介,或奖励系统的一部分。这些代币可以在平台内用于交易、参加活动,甚至在未来的一些应用中进行兑换,形成一个相对闭环的生意生态圈。
以上盈利模式可依据不同用户群和市场需求灵活调整,各项目方可通过多条路径实现盈利,从而确保平台的可持续发展。
#### 如何吸引用户加入社交平台区块链项目?
吸引用户的关键在于提供独特的价值,并确保用户体验的良好。以下是一些可行的策略:
- **用户教育**:由于区块链技术仍然相对陌生,开展用户教育活动非常重要。通过举办线上的知识分享、引导视频等方式,让用户了解区块链的益处和操作方法,增强他们的参与感。
- **用户激励**:可以通过具有吸引力的奖励机制,激励用户参与平台活动。比如,用户可以因邀请新用户而获得代币奖励,或因活跃发言质量而获得内容创作者奖励等。
- **功能丰富**:提供用户所需的多元化功能,例如多媒体分享、交易、社区互动等。这不仅能吸引用户加入,也能提高用户的黏性和活跃度。
- **建立社区**:社交平台本质上是用户之间的互动网络,建立良好的社区氛围能够吸引更多人加入。在此过程中,要建立合理的社群自治机制,使用户对平台的发展有一定的话语权。
- **积极的品牌宣传**:利用社交媒体、KOL推广、线下活动等多种渠道进行宣传,逐渐打响品牌知名度。
通过以上多种方式组合,您能够有效吸引到目标用户,为平台的快速发展奠定基础。
#### 社交平台区块链项目的未来发展趋势如何?
随着区块链技术的发展,社交平台未来的趋势主要集中在以下几个方面:
- **去中心化的主流趋势**:用户对数据隐私与安全的重视将推动去中心化社交平台的增长。越来越多的用户希望掌控自己的数据并了解其使用方式,这为去中心化平台提供了发展机遇。
- **合规性与监管**:随着区块链和数字货币逐逐渐入轨,国家对于区块链社交平台的监管政策也将日益重要。未来,符合监管要求的平台将更具竞争力。
- **与传统社交平台的竞争与合作**:虽然去中心化社交平台面临与传统社交平台的竞争,但也有可能与传统企业建立合作关系,通过归约创新来互补发展。
- **多功能一体化平台**:未来社交平台将逐渐不是单一的社交功能,而是集社交、交易、内容创作于一体的多功能平台,通过区块链技术提供更高效的资源流动。
综上所述,社交平台区块链项目的发展前景广阔。不断演进的市场和技术环境,将为下一个具有颠覆性的社交平台提供无限可能。
### 总结
构建一个高效的社交平台区块链项目是一个复杂而充实的过程,涵盖了从概念构想到技术实现,再到运营维护的各个步骤。由于区块链特性带来的安全性、透明性,以及去中心化的用户体验,未来该领域的将继续吸引广泛的关注与投资。希望本文能够为您在社交平台区块链项目的开发过程中提供有价值的参考和指导。
